Regulatory Shuffle: What Dutch Players Need to Know

Since the Remote Gambling Act came into effect in October 2021, the Netherlands has been trying to strike a balance between control and freedom. The Dutch Gambling Authority (Kansspelautoriteit) is now the gatekeeper, issuing licenses to operators who meet strict criteria. Sounds reassuring, right? Well, it’s a bit like trusting a dealer who’s also the pit boss—there’s oversight, but the house still holds the cards.

Licensed operators must adhere to rules designed to protect players, such as deposit limits and self-exclusion options. However, the enforcement can sometimes feel like a game of roulette—some operators play by the book, others find loopholes. For the average punter, this means vigilance is key. Blind trust is a gamble in itself.

Popular Payment Methods: Convenience or Catch?

In the Netherlands, iDEAL remains the darling of payment options for online casinos. It’s fast, familiar, and widely accepted, making deposits and withdrawals smoother than a well-oiled slot machine. But don’t be fooled—some casinos still throw in less transparent fees or delay payouts under the guise of “security checks.”

  • iDEAL: Instant and widely used
  • Credit/Debit Cards: Visa and Mastercard accepted but sometimes slower
  • E-wallets: Skrill and Neteller, offering anonymity but not always supported
  • Bank Transfers: Reliable but can take several days

Choosing the right payment method can feel like picking the right hand in blackjack—one wrong move and you’re stuck waiting or losing value. Always check the fine print before committing your cash.

Game Variety: More Than Just Spinning Reels?

Contrary to popular belief, Dutch online casinos don’t just offer a dizzying array of slots. Table games, live dealer options, and even niche categories like virtual sports have found their way into the mix. Yet, the quality and fairness of these games can be as unpredictable as a high-stakes poker bluff.

Software providers like NetEnt, Evolution Gaming, and Play’n GO dominate the market, but beware of lesser-known developers that pop up without much track record. It’s a bit like trusting a new card shark at the table—sometimes they’re legit, sometimes they’re just out to clean your pockets.

Bonuses and Promotions: The Fine Print You Shouldn’t Ignore

Ah, bonuses—the siren call of online casinos. While Dutch operators do offer welcome bonuses and promotions, the devil is always in the details. Wagering requirements, game restrictions, and expiration dates can turn what looks like a free lunch into a costly meal.

Bonus Type Typical Wagering Requirement Common Restrictions Player Tip
Welcome Bonus 30x – 50x Slots only, max bet limits Read terms carefully before claiming
No Deposit Bonus 40x – 60x Limited withdrawal amounts Use for testing, not cashing out
Reload Bonus 20x – 40x Game restrictions apply Check expiry dates
Cashback Usually none May exclude certain games Good for reducing losses

Responsible Gambling: More Than Just a Buzzword

With all the glitz and potential pitfalls, responsible gambling measures are crucial. Dutch casinos are required to provide tools like deposit limits, self-exclusion, and reality checks. However, the effectiveness of these tools depends largely on player discipline—no magic wand here.
